Popular comedian Nate Bargatze and cruise festival company Sixthman have announced a new comedy cruise called “Nateland at Sea.” The voyage will take place from February 5-9, 2026 aboard Norwegian Jewel from Tampa to Costa Maya.
Nateland at Sea will include three stand-up performances by Bargatze, live tapings of his Nateland podcast, and sets from comedians including John Crist, Aaron Weber, Dusty Slay, Derrick Stroup, Brian Bates, and Greg Warren. Additional events will include:
- A Southern Spelling Bee
- Magic performances by Nate’s father, Stephen Bargatze
- Bargatze Bowl (a Super Bowl watch party)
- Bellyflop competition
- Themed nights
More performers and events will be announced at a later date.

Beyond the activities and events on board, guests will have the opportunity to enjoy Costa Maya, Mexico. Activities there will include hitting the beach, trying local cuisine, and exploring Mayan ruins. Shore excursions will open for booking four to six weeks prior to the cruise.
Pre-sale sign-ups are now open, with the first round closing on Sunday, February 9th. The final round will close on February 16th. Public sales will begin on February 19th at natelandatsea.com. Deposits are $100 per person, with automatic monthly billing before June 8th. The first 500 bookings will receive an exclusive onboard photo opportunity with Bargatze.
